Dec 6, 2021 · My hi hat cymbals do not align precisely. By that I mean that when you close them the perimeter edge of one doesn't align with the mating perimeter edge of the other; there's overlap; they can be mis-aligned by up to ~ 3/16". Jul 30, 2010 · I've heard of guys using 16 " cymbals for Hi-hats. I use 15" myself...fairly thin cymbals (1950's Zildjians) and they work great. Don't get too hung up on the type the manufacturer ink stamps on a cymbal...see what works for you. I think someone posted a picture here a while back of a couple of 20" cymbals on their hi-hat.

Jan 26, 2009 · I use a DW5000 hi hat stand. I use the shorter rod with a drop clutch. I have the top of the clutch about 1/2" from the top of the rod. That puts the cymbals edge at about 6" from the top of my snare drum. I've been playing this way since I started around 9 …

Nov 3, 2018 · I play double-bass. So, when I set the hi-hat I press the hi-hat pedal and the left bass drum pedal down at the same time. When the bass drum pedal hits the drum, that's where I set my hi-hat pedal. I think there's about an inch between the cymbals. That way everything goes down the same distance.

Mar 7, 2010 · Also, set three prameters the same: 1. the same clutch with same number of felts and same tension holding top cymbal in place in clutch 2. the same distance (air space) between the two cymbals when in full open position 3. hihat cymbals at exact same height and same distance to your ear
